In a manner that involves entry into the body, typically by cutting or puncturing the skin or by inserting instruments into the body. The procedure was performed invasively, requiring a small incision to access the affected area.
In a way that intrudes on a person's privacy or personal space. The reporter asked questions invasively, making the interviewee uncomfortable.
In a manner that spreads harmfully or destructively, often used in reference to plants or species. The plant species spread invasively, overtaking the native vegetation in the area.
